To maximize the lifespan of tungsten steel milling cutters, proper maintenance and care are essential. After usage, it is important to clean the milling cutters thoroughly and remove any chips or debris. Regular inspection of the cutting edges for signs of wear or damage is necessary, and any worn or damaged cutters should be replaced promptly to ensure optimal machining results.

 

Furthermore, storing the milling cutters in a clean and dry environment, preferably in a protective case or holder, can prevent corrosion and maintain their performance. Following the manufacturer’s recommendations for lubrication and cooling during cutting operations is also crucial to minimize heat generation and prolong the tool life.
